C语言改错例题.docVIP

  • 217
  • 0
  • 约1.53万字
  • 约 57页
  • 2016-12-10 发布于重庆
  • 举报
C语言改错例题

/* 1.【程序改错】 题目:在一个已按升序排列的数组中插入一个数,插入后,数组元素仍按升序排列。程序中共有4条错误语句,请改正错误。 注意:不可以增加或删除程序行,也不可以更改程序的结构。 #define N 11 mainint i,j,t,number,a[N]1,2,4,6,8,9,12,15,149,156; printfplease enter an integer to insert in the array:\n; /**********FOUND**********/ scanf%d,number printfThe original array:\n; fori0;iN-1;i++printf%5d,a[i]; printf\n; /**********FOUND**********/ foriN-1;i0;i--ifnumbera[i] /**********FOUND**********/a[i]a[i-1];elsea[i+1]number; /**********FOUND**********/exit; ifnumbera[0] a[0]number;printfThe result array:\n; fori0;iN;i++printf%5d,a[i]; printf\n;/* 2【程序改错】 题目:下面程序的功能是利用

文档评论(0)

1亿VIP精品文档

相关文档